Tips for Leaving the Past Behind
So, how do you actually *do* this? Here are a few simple ideas:
- Practice mindfulness. Focus on the present moment. What do you see? What do you feel?
- Forgive yourself. Everyone makes mistakes. It's part of being human.
- Set goals for the future. Give yourself something to look forward to.
- Surround yourself with positive people. Their energy is contagious!
- Engage in activities you enjoy. Hobbies are a great distraction.
It’s also very helpful to forgive those that might have wronged you in the past. Carrying resentment doesn’t hurt them; it only hurts you.
